Transport proteins allow ___ type of substance to move across the membrane

1 Answer

4 votes

Answer:

Ions, sugars, amino acids, and sometimes water

Step-by-step explanation:

Those substances are unable to diffuse across the membrane, so they use an ATP-powered ion pump, channels, and transporters to be transported across the membrane.
